Crystal Palace boss Roy Hodgson says Liverpool look like title contenders.
Hodgson's Palace face his former club today.
He said: "It's a big club. It's a long time since I was there.
"The people who employed me weren't the people who took over the club and have carried it forward.
"It was a very different Liverpool that I joined to the one we see today, because the one we see today has had a lot of money invested in it. We didn't have any money to spend. They've spent a few bob over the last couple of years.
"Liverpool have been good for, say, the last two seasons. They're getting better all the time and last season was a marvellous season for them, reaching the Champions League final.
"This year they are looking if anything ready to kick on from that and mount an even stronger challenge in the league."
